X-Git-Url: https://git.saurik.com/apple/xnu.git/blobdiff_plain/c18c124eaa464aaaa5549e99e5a70fc9cbb50944..3e170ce000f1506b7b5d2c5c7faec85ceabb573d:/libsyscall/wrappers/cancelable/fcntl-base.c diff --git a/libsyscall/wrappers/cancelable/fcntl-base.c b/libsyscall/wrappers/cancelable/fcntl-base.c index c8808f3ae..e421e0af4 100644 --- a/libsyscall/wrappers/cancelable/fcntl-base.c +++ b/libsyscall/wrappers/cancelable/fcntl-base.c @@ -40,9 +40,15 @@ fcntl(int fd, int cmd, ...) va_start(ap, cmd); switch(cmd) { case F_GETLK: + case F_GETLKPID: case F_SETLK: case F_SETLKW: case F_SETLKWTIMEOUT: + case F_OFD_GETLK: + case F_OFD_GETLKPID: + case F_OFD_SETLK: + case F_OFD_SETLKW: + case F_OFD_SETLKWTIMEOUT: case F_PREALLOCATE: case F_SETSIZE: case F_RDADVISE: @@ -57,6 +63,7 @@ fcntl(int fd, int cmd, ...) case F_ADDSIGS: case F_ADDFILESIGS: case F_ADDFILESIGS_FOR_DYLD_SIM: + case F_ADDFILESIGS_RETURN: case F_FINDSIGS: case F_TRANSCODEKEY: arg = va_arg(ap, void *);